Reporting to the Supervisor of Traffic Services, the Traffic Engineering Technologist provides support to the Municipal Traffic Authority in the establishment of all aspects of traffic control within the municipal roadway network. The Traffic Engineering Technologist is responsible for providing technical support in relation to all types of traffic control devices including traffic signals, on-street pavement markings, traffic signs, traffic calming devices and parking control zones. Traffic control requests are received from and information is provided to Council, the public, internal business units and external agencies.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Assesses requests for various traffic controls (such as traffic signals, signs, and pavement markings) and makes recommendations to the Traffic Authority regarding appropriate implementation of safe and effective traffic control measures;

Prepares official traffic control regulations for approval by the Traffic Authority;

Initiates and coordinates implementation of approved traffic regulations by municipal crews or others and confirms completion of the work;

Analyses data, undertakes, participates in and coordinates various traffic engineering studies (traffic signal warrants, all-way stop warrants, crosswalk warrants, turn-lane warrants, protected turn signal phasing assessments, sight line assessments, etc.);

Identifies and initiates various traffic engineering surveys related to traffic and pedestrian volumes, travel patterns, and vehicle speeds;

Reviews development and construction proposals, providing input and direction regarding traffic control and transportation design requirements;

Prepares and contributes to reports and presentations to Regional Council and external groups related to various traffic control matters;

Maintains various datasets and records related to traffic control device inventories

Represents the Traffic Authority and Traffic Management on various internal and external project and steering committees;

Answers public inquiries concerning traffic matters.

Ensures the integrity of the regional transportation network is protected through strategic review of land acquisition / surplus inquiries;

May perform other related duties as assigned.
